What is a Remote 500 Ton Master Captain?

A Remote 500 Ton Master Captain is a licensed maritime professional who is authorized to command vessels up to 500 gross tons, often in offshore or coastal environments. The 'remote' aspect typically means the captain may operate in distant locations or manage operations that require extended periods away from home. These captains oversee the safe navigation, crew management, and compliance with maritime laws for their vessel. They are responsible for ensuring the safety of passengers, crew, and cargo, as well as maintaining the seaworthiness of the vessel. A 500 Ton Master Captain must hold a specific U.S. Coast Guard license and have extensive experience in maritime operations.

What is the difference between Remote 500 Ton Master Captain vs Remote 100 Ton Captain?

AspectRemote 500 Ton Master CaptainRemote 100 Ton Captain
Required CredentialsUSCG Master License (500 Ton or higher)USCG Captain License (100 Ton)
Work EnvironmentLarge vessels, commercial shipping, offshore operationsSmaller boats, inland or nearshore operations
Industry UsageCommercial maritime, offshore oil & gas, cargoRecreational, small commercial vessels

The Remote 500 Ton Master Captain typically oversees larger vessels requiring a 500 Ton license, often in commercial and offshore settings. The Remote 100 Ton Captain operates smaller vessels with a 100 Ton license, mainly in inland or recreational contexts. The main differences lie in vessel size, licensing requirements, and work environment, with the 500 Ton Master Captain handling more complex and larger vessels.
